Background:
Patients with memory concerns but negative Positron Emission Tomography (PET) amyloid scans pose significant diagnostic challenges, requiring differentiation between non-Alzheimer's disease (AD) pathologies. Limbic-predominant Age-related TDP-43 Encephalopathy (LATE) has emerged as a notable alternative diagnosis, characterized by impaired delayed recall, preserved verbal fluency, and medial temporal atrophy12. Understanding the cognitive and MRI features that distinguish amyloid-negative from amyloid-positive patients is essential for refining diagnostic accuracy METHOD: This descriptive study included 56 patients with cognitive complaint (28 amyloid-PET- negative, 28 amyloid -PET-positive) who were evaluated between 2023 and 2025 at the UHN Memory Clinic and had a positron emission tomography (PET), MRI and Toronto Cognitive Assessment (ToRCA). Demographic, cognitive, amyloid PET scan and MRI data were compared, with medians and interquartile ranges (IQR) reported for non-normally distributed variables.
Result:
Both groups had similar age (70.0 [65.5-76.8] vs. 74.5 [66.0-78.0], p = 0.768) and sex distribution (57.1% male, p = 1.000). Amnestic MCI was more frequent in the amyloid-negative group (89.3% vs. 57.1%, p = 0.016), while dementia was more common in the amyloid-positive group. Amyloid-negative patients showed better delayed recall (3.00 [2.75-5.00] vs. 1.00 [0.00-3.25], p = 0.008), delayed recognition (19.00 [16.00-20.00] vs. 17.00 [12.00-18.00], p = 0.006), and visuospatial memory (Benson Figure Delayed Recall: 10.00 [8.00-12.00] vs. 8.00 [3.00-10.25], p = 0.021) than the amyloid-positive group. Semantic fluency (animals) was also higher (16.00 [12.00-18.25] vs. 13.00 [7.75-15.25], p = 0.006) in the amyloid-negative patients, while lexical fluency (F words) was comparable (p = 0.134). There were no significant differences in global cortical atrophy or moderate-to-severe atrophy of the medial temporal lobes.
Conclusion:
This descriptive study suggests that amyloid-negative patients are more likely to present with aMCI than dementia, and exhibit milder memory deficits than amyloid-positive patients, aligning with reports that LATE may be less severe than AD. Though referral bias may partly explain the higher proportion of aMCI in the amyloid-negative group, these findings underscore the need to consider non-AD pathologies in patients with memory complaints and negative amyloid scans. Future research may elucidate distinct clinical signatures to improve diagnostic workflows in memory clinics.
